The Proctorline queue API is what shuffles candidates into available invigilator slots, and yes, it's pickier about auth than you'd expect. Every call to `/queue/enroll` and `/queue/advance` needs a bearer token minted by the Proctorline identity service — session cookies won't cut it, and the old basic-auth path was ripped out last spring. Tokens are scoped per exam window, so grab a fresh one per run. For local testing, use this one:

session JWT of yawep-yawep = eyJhbGciOiJIUzI1NiIsInR5cCI6IkpXVCJ9.eyJzdWIiOiI3pWF3_In0.aXYsHiog

## LiftYard Simulator — Restart Procedure

The LiftYard elevator-dispatch simulator at Harrowgate Labs must be restarted whenever the cab-routing matrix is rebuilt. Stop the scheduler first, then flush the dispatch queue so stale hall calls are not replayed. Before relaunching, verify that config/liftyard.env still contains the simulator's broker credentials; losing them silently disables car assignment. Open the file, confirm the broker host line, and append the authentication token on the line directly below it.

vault entry, yahif-yajep: COURIER_KEY29=b802bdf8034096b65a51c6ba5abe2

# FeedCheck Environments

FeedCheck validates podcast RSS feeds for the Murmuration platform. Two environments: sandbox (accepts anything, logs loudly) and prod (strict mode, rejects malformed enclosures). Reviewers: most PRs only need sandbox testing, but anything touching the schema validator should be smoke-tested against prod-like settings. To save you digging, the prod configuration currently looks like this.

settings of yahag-yafog:
[pramir]
host = pramir.qirvancorp.internal
user = pramir_svc
database = pramir_prod

## Who to ping about GiftNote

Welcome aboard! GiftNote is our donation-receipt mailer for the Larchfield Fund. Template tweaks go to the comms folks; delivery failures and bounce weirdness go to the platform crew. Don't push template changes on Fridays — receipts batch over the weekend. For anything GiftNote-related, start with the address below.

billing contact of kaweg-tajeg = drudor.lamion.oliath@torvalabs.test